Transaction 3e4d40a0f18202375db6cf513d034e5f202bb37ff068e36565f12a990ceff144

block
bb9908581414b7d82c3bb761c2d52f40121a32cf289323f5d6f24872ed868da1

42 Inputs

2 Outputs